What's the difference between cacao and chocolate?

Chocolate and cacao are two different things but they are often confused.
Even experts will often use the word chocolate when in fact they mean raw cacao beans.
Cacao or cacao beans are the raw ingredient used to make chocolate.
Chocolate = Choco-late
Choco = Cacao
Late = Milk